A place to stay in Andermatt
Hotel & Restaurant Zum Schwarzen Bären sits in the village centre of Andermatt, Switzerland, with an on-site restaurant and bar, a terrace and private parking. It's pet friendly, has family rooms, and runs an airport shuttle. Two room types are on offer: an 18 m² Superior Double Room with a queen bed, and a 40 m² Junior Suite that adds a sofa bed. Both have mountain and city views, a flat-screen TV, a coffee machine and free wifi. Prices start at CHF 268.

In the village centre
The property stands in the centre of Andermatt, so shops, lifts and village life are reached on foot. Rooms look out over the mountains or the town itself, and there's a terrace with outdoor furniture for fair-weather days.
Rooms and views
The Superior Double Room is a compact 18 m² with a queen bed, while the Junior Suite stretches to 40 m² with a queen bed and a sofa bed. All rooms are non-smoking, with attached bathrooms, coffee machines, flat-screen TVs and mountain or city views.
Restaurant, bar and terrace
An on-site restaurant and bar cover meals and après drinks without leaving the building, and breakfast is rated well by guests. The terrace with outdoor furniture gives an outdoor option when the weather cooperates.
Set up for the slopes
Ski storage keeps gear organised between days on the mountain, and a ski school is available at an additional charge. The winter season here runs roughly early December to mid-April; summer, mid-June to late September, brings hiking, cycling and bike tours.
